pythonでpipでサードパーティライブラリをインストールするときのエラー解決方法

pipでサードパーティ製ライブラリをインストールする際にエラーが発生した場合は、次の解決方法を試すことができます。

  1. Pipのバージョンの確認:Pipが最新か確認し、最新のバージョンでない場合はpip install –upgrade pipコマンドでアップグレード
  2. ネットワーク接続を確認: ネットワーク接続が有効であることを確認し、プロキシを使用している場合は、プロキシを設定します。
  3. ミラーソースの変更:デフォルトのミラーソースを使用すると、ダウンロード速度が遅くなったり、エラーが発生したりする場合があります。他のミラーソースを使用してインストールを試すことができます。たとえば、次のコマンドを使用して、清華大学のミラーソースを使用できます:pip install -i https://pypi.tuna.tsinghua.edu.cn/simple 。
  4. 仮想環境を使う場合:仮想環境を利用している場合は、事前に仮想環境を有効にしてからインストールを行ってください。
  5. 入力したライブラリー名が正しいかどうか(PyPI に存在するかどうか)を確認してください。
  6. 依存関係の競合の解決:特定のライブラリをインストールしたときに依存関係に競合が発生する場合があります。関連する依存ライブラリのアップグレードまたはダウングレード、またはライブラリの他のバージョンを使用してみてください。
  7. –no-cache-dir オプションを使用する: pipキャッシュがインストール時のエラーの原因となる場合、pip install –no-cache-dir コマンドでインストールできます。
  8. 手動インストール:その他の方法でも解決できない場合は、ライブラリのインストールパッケージを手動でダウンロードして、pipでローカルインストールを試します。まず PyPI でライブラリページを見つけて .wheel または .tar.gz ファイルをダウンロードし、pip install コマンドを使用してインストールします。

上記の方法でも解決しない場合は、関連するエラーメッセージを検索するか、ライブラリのドキュメントやGitHubページのFAQや解決策を確認してください。

bannerAds